Fast Clock Setting. This operation enables fast switching from PMC Enabled SuperI/O Disabled state to SuperI/O Enabled
PMC Enabled state.
The HFCG maintains an internal I variable for the 96 MHz clock. The I variable is defined by two byte-wide registers: HFCGIL
and HFCGIH. In a LOAD96 operation, the frequency multiplier automatically searches for the I value needed to lock onto
the target frequency. The locking process can take several milliseconds to complete. The I variable can be recorded for the
96 MHz setting and used later to reduce the time needed for frequency locking.
To record the 96 MHz I value:
1. Write the required HFCGP value.
2. Enter any of the SuperI/O Enabled states using the Normal clock setting or Hardware clock setting process.
To fast set a 96 MHz clock frequency:
1. Write the required HFCGP value.
2. Set FAST96 bit in HFCGCTRL1 register to 1.
The HFCGN, HFCGML and HFCGMH registers are ignored and left unchanged when switching to SuperI/O Enabled states.
4.18.4 The Programmable Pre-Scaler: Core Domain Clock Generation
The core domain clock (CLK) is driven from OSCCLK via a 5-bit pre-scaler. When in PMC Enabled SuperI/O Disabled state,
the pre-scaler divides by 1. In SuperI/O Enabled PMC Disabled state, the pre-scaler is programmable, as defined in HFCGP
register. In other states, the core-domain clock is disabled.
The core domain clock may be set in the range of 4 MHz to 20 MHz.
When LOAD96 or FAST96 bit in HFCGCTRL1 register is set (1), the pre-scaler is set to the value held in HFCGP register
(core frequency = 96 MHz / (HFCGP +1)).
When in SuperI/O Enabled PMC Enabled state, a write to HFCGP register changes the core’s frequency at the next cycle
of the pre-scaler.
When LOAD or FAST bit in HFCGCTRL1 register is set (1), the pre-scaler is automatically set to a divide by 1. The contents
of HFCGP are unchanged.
When in SuperI/O Enabled PMC Enabled state or SuperI/O Enabled PMC Disabled state, Watchdog reset or Debugger In-
terface reset sets HFCGP to its reset value and initializes the pre-scaler using this value; see Section 4.18.6 on page 216
for details about setting the pre-scaler during state transitions.
When in Disabled state or PMC Enabled and SuperI/O Disabled state, Watchdog reset or Debugger Interface reset keeps
the pre-scaler in the divide by 1 operation and loads the HFCGP to its reset value.
